Font Size: a A A

Based On Quadratic B-spline Curve, Surface Approximation Algorithm

Posted on:2009-08-23Degree:MasterType:Thesis
Country:ChinaCandidate:J F WangFull Text:PDF
GTID:2190360245979426Subject:Computational Mathematics
Abstract/Summary:PDF Full Text Request
The developments of Computational Geometry, Computer Graphic motivate the developments of modern industry, manufacturing. In turn, the developments of modern industry, manufacturing put forward higher requests to Computational Geometry, Computer Graphic, especially in curve, surface approximation field. But the traditional interpolation, approximation algorithm both have advantages and disadvantages.After research the curve approximation algorithm in reference[1],we use the square B-Spline as the tool and extend the algorithm to surface approximation field.This algorithm avoided their disadvantages and combined their advantages of interpolation,fitting algorithm.The algorithm provided in this text is general and it can be expaned to other field, such as spline approximation, function approximation and the curve fitting.The primary contributions of this paper contain the following points:1) Research the advantages and disadvantages of the traditional methods of spline curve, surface interpolation and approximation algorithm.2) Research the curve approximation algorithm provided in reference[1].Revised some data error. Perfect it's theories proof. Carry on more strict, more general numerical experiment.3) According to the request of suface approximation in modern industry, we setup mathematics model.Put forward the concept of structure vector, structure matrix.4) We expanded the curve approximation algorithm to surface approximation field successfully, and carried on theories proof. Considering it is difficult to express the iteration process in mathematics language, we put forward matrix2vector method.5) Research smooth property of the B-Spline surface. We carried on strict theories poof about smooth properties at the connection field of the surfcae.6) Useing OpenGL, Matlab etc. as painting tools, we carried on approximate effect experiment, numerical experiment.
Keywords/Search Tags:Control points, structure vector, structure matrix, iterate algorithm, matrix2vector method, numerical experiment
PDF Full Text Request
Related items